KRISTA BURSEY PSYCHE, 2025 INK ON SKIN8 x 4 INCHES Heliodreams : Mediterranean Dream Studies Inspired by a series of four original metallic watercolor paintings created in Pylos, Greece, Heliodreams explores the relationship between sunlight, color, perception, and transformation. Developed beneath the shifting Mediterranean sun, these works emerged through experiments with metallic watercolor pigments, evolving into a visual language that blends nature, mythology, symbolism, and dreams. About the Artwork Psyche captures a moment of transformation suspended in flight. Unfolding in luminous shades of pink, cream, gold, and soft greens, its wings echo the shifting colours of the Mediterranean sky, where light continuously reshapes the landscape. In Ancient Greek, the word psyche means both "soul" and "butterfly," linking the natural world to the inner journey of growth and becoming. Delicate yet resilient, the butterfly has long symbolized transformation, emergence, and the unfolding of one's true nature. Its symmetrical form creates a sense of balance and grace, while intricate markings and flowing contours suggest movement, freedom, and possibility. The design inhabits the space between what is and what is becoming—a reflection of the invisible changes that shape our lives.
